What Is an Air Fryer ?
An air fryer is a small kitchen tool that cooks food by blowing hot air around it . It works like shallow frying but without dunking in oil , so it's healthier . Inside is a heating part and a fan that move hot air fast to make a crispy layer and cook inside .
These devices blew up in the 2010s when makers added digital screens and timers . Now you see them in a lot of kitchens because they save time and space . People use them not just for frying but also for baking , roasting and grilling .
What sets an air fryer apart is that you only need a tiny bit of oil (or none) to get food that tastes like it was deep fried . So you cut fat and calories but keep taste and crunch .

How to Cook Air Fryer Eggs
4.1. Hard-Boiled Eggs
Ingredients : Eggs , salt & pepper (opt)
Directions :
- Preheat air fryer to 270°F (130°C) .
- Place eggs in basket in a single layer .
- Cook 9 min for soft , 12 min for medium , 15 min for hard .
- Move eggs to ice bath and chill 5 min .
- Peel under running water to make it easier .
Tip : Sprinkle salt , pepper or paprika before serving .
4.2. Scrambled Eggs in an Air Fryer
Ingredients : Eggs , splash of milk (opt) , salt , pepper , cheese or herbs (opt)
Directions :
- In a bowl , whisk eggs , milk , salt and pepper .
- Grease basket or use small baking dish .
- Pour egg mix in and set fryer to 300°F (150°C) .
- Cook 8–10 min , stirring once halfway .
Serve with : Toast , avocado or inside a breakfast burrito .
4.3. Mini Frittatas
Ingredients : Eggs , chopped veggies (peppers , spinach) , cheese , salt , pepper
Directions :
- Heat air fryer to 300°F (150°C) .
- Whisk eggs , salt and pepper , then stir in veggies and cheese .
- Pour into silicone muffin cups or small dish .
- Cook 12–15 min until puffy and set .
Customize : Add bacon bits , fresh herbs or hot sauce .
4.4. Soft-Boiled Eggs
Ingredients : Eggs
Directions :
- Preheat air fryer to 270°F (130°C) .
- Place eggs in basket .
- Cook 6–7 min for gooey yolk .
- Transfer to ice bath , wait a few min , then peel .
Serve with : Soldiers of toasted bread , avocado toast or salad .
Tips for Cooking Eggs in an Air Fryer
- Adjust Time : Bigger eggs need more minutes .
- Preheat : Always heat fryer first foг best results .
- Use Silicone Molds : They help shape frittatas and scramble neat .
- Watch Closely : Check on your eggs so they don’t overcook .
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Overcrowding : Too many eggs = uneven cooking .
- Wrong Time : Not all eggs cook same ; adjust for size .
- No Preheat : Skipping this leads to soggy whites .
- Peel Too Soon : Let eggs cool so shells come off easy .
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Can you put raw eggs in an air fryer ? Yes , you can cook raw eggs right in the fryer , but use a mold or small dish .
What temp for air fryer eggs ? Usually between 270°F to 300°F (130°C–150°C) works best .
How long for hard-boiled in air fryer ? About 15 min will give you firm yolks .
Are air fryer eggs healthy ? Yep , with almost no oil they’re lower in fat but still tasty .
Can i use an egg carton ? Stick to silicone molds or baking dishes instead of the carton .

air fryer eggs
Equipment
- 1 air fryer
- 1 mixing bowl
- 1 whisk or fork
- 1 silicone molds or ramekins
Ingredients
- 16 large eggs
- 1 tablespoon milk Optional for scrambled eggs.
- to taste salt To taste for scrambled eggs.
- to taste pepper To taste for scrambled eggs.
- 1 tablespoon butter or oil Optional for greasing molds.
Instructions
- Preheat the air fryer to 270°F (130°C) for hard-boiled eggs.
- Place the eggs in the air fryer basket, ensuring they are not touching to prevent cracking.
- Cook the eggs for 12 minutes for hard-boiled.
- Immediately transfer the eggs into a bowl of ice water and let sit for 5 minutes to cool down before peeling.
- In a mixing b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, salt, and pepper for scrambled eggs.
- Preheat the air fryer to 275°F (135°C) for scrambled eggs.
- Grease silicone molds or ramekins with butter or oil.
- Pour the egg mixture evenly into the molds, filling them about halfway to allow for expansion.
- Cook in the air fryer for 8-10 minutes, checking for doneness. Stir halfway through if desired for a fluffier texture.
- Always check the internal temperature of the eggs to ensure they are fully cooked: 160°F (70°C) is the safe temperature for eggs.
